+ // We should generate an X86ISD::BLENDI from a vselect if its argument
+ // is a sign_extend_inreg of an any_extend of a BUILD_VECTOR of
+ // constants. This specific pattern gets generated when we split a
+ // selector for a 512 bit vector in a machine without AVX512 (but with
+ // 256-bit vectors), during legalization:
+ //
+ // (vselect (sign_extend (any_extend (BUILD_VECTOR)) i1) LHS RHS)
+ //
+ // Iff we find this pattern and the build_vectors are built from
+ // constants, we translate the vselect into a shuffle_vector that we
+ // know will be matched by LowerVECTOR_SHUFFLEtoBlend.
+ if ((N->getOpcode() == ISD::VSELECT ||
+ N->getOpcode() == X86ISD::SHRUNKBLEND) &&
+ !DCI.isBeforeLegalize()) {
+ SDValue Shuffle = transformVSELECTtoBlendVECTOR_SHUFFLE(N, DAG, Subtarget);
+ if (Shuffle.getNode())
+ return Shuffle;
+ }
